About
The Rugby Africa Women's Cup takes place annually between the top African teams. In 2024, the Springbok Women successfully defended their title in Madagascar against the host nation, Kenya and Cameroon, booking their place at Rugby World Cup 2025. The tournament will again take place at Stade Makis in Antananarivo in 2025, with Uganda replacing Cameroon as one of the four competing nations.
